Key Areas of Knowledge in RCM Training
Overview of RCM: Introduction to the revenue cycle management process, including its importance in healthcare finance and operations.
Key Components of RCM: Detailed exploration of the various stages of the revenue cycle, including patient registration, insurance verification, charge capture, coding, billing, and collections.
Medical Coding Fundamentals: Training on ICD-10-CM, CPT, and HCPCS coding systems, emphasizing accurate coding for optimal reimbursement.
Billing and Claims Management: Understanding the billing process, including claim submission, tracking, and managing denials and appeals.
Compliance and Regulations: Overview of healthcare regulations, including HIPAA and CMS guidelines, ensuring compliance throughout the revenue cycle.
Financial Management: Insights into financial reporting, accounts receivable management, and key performance indicators (KPIs) in RCM.
Technology in RCM: Familiarization with RCM software and tools that streamline processes and improve efficiency.
Best Practices: Strategies for optimizing the revenue cycle, reducing denials, and improving cash flow.
